I used to come here very regularly for the lunch buffet before covid. They shut down the buffet for a couple of years and I just realized they had it back! It is very good still. I'm glad I came back.
Changes to note: Payment was up front. Not a bad thing just didn't realize it. You get your own drinks now instead of the waiter filling. They will pick up your plates but a lot of people bus their own table.
It was no where near as busy as it once was but I was happy and plan on coming again. Food was still great, people still nice.

Happen to stop by the restaurant since it’s so close to NCSU. They had the buffet available when I came (seems like it’s only for lunch 11-2:30). Drink was included and there’s a decent variety of food for the price. I really like their black pepper chicken and spicy fried fish. There was also roast duck, shredded pork garlic sauce, and mussels. Will be back for quick lunch and also to try takeout.
